The National Monuments Service's description

On a NW-facing slope of rising reclaimed grassland in the Slieveardagh hills with good views from S through W to N, higher ground to E. Located on the edge of a natural fall of ground overlooking marshy land to N and W. Nearby ringfort (TS049-023----) 230m to the E. Ringfort consists of a slightly raised circular area (diam. 24m N-S; 27m NW-SE) enclosed by an earth and stone bank (top Wth 1.7m; base Wth 3.5m; ext. H 1.1m; int. H 0.2m ) reduced to a scarp in places and outer fosse (base Wth 1.5m top Wth 2.5m; ext. D 0.25m). Possible entrance feature (Wth 3m) at SE. Interior has been quarried into at NW, enclosing bank shows evidence of cattle poaching along S edge, several cattle gaps in bank.
